Pricing: Dots vs. Tipalti

Features
Dots logo Dots
Tipalti
Platform pricing
Core is $19 per month, Scale is $999 per month, and Enterprise is custom.
Tipalti Mass Payments starts at $249 per month, and Accounts Payable starts at $99 per month. Routable estimates a $4,000-$5,000 implementation fee and $500-$600 per month for Tipalti Premium, based on conversations with former Tipalti customers.
Domestic payout
$2 on Core and $1 on Scale
Routable estimates ACH at about $1 per transaction and local bank transfers at $1-$1.50.
Instant payout fee
$0 on Core and Scale
Not published.
International payout
3.9% plus $2 on Core and 2.9% plus $1 on Scale
Routable estimates international ACH at $5-$6 per transaction. Wire estimates run from $20-$36, with FX at 1.9%-3.5%.

Compare the operating work

Payout methods and reach: Dots supports 190+ countries through 300+ rails. Tipalti offers ACH, wire transfer, checks, Tipalti Card, and local payment methods by country. Available routes vary by country, payout method, contract, and account configuration.

Onboarding and payee ownership: Dots can collect identity, payout, and tax information inside a fully white-label flow. Tipalti uses supplier and payee portal with finance approval, reconciliation, and ERP workflows.

Tax and compliance: Dots ties identity checks, payout history, and tax status to one payee record. Tipalti provides automated tax form collection and compliance within supplier or mass-payment workflows.
